> Location permission lost for Windows Phone 8.1
> ----------------------------------------------
>
> Key: CB-10845
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CB-10845
> Project: Apache Cordova
> Issue Type: Bug
> Components: Plugin Geolocation, Windows
> Environment: Windows Phone 8.1
> Reporter: Steffen Schaffert
> Assignee: Vladimir Kotikov
>
> After updating to the latest Cordova versions (cordova-cli 6.0.0,
> cordova-windows 4.3.1, cordova-plugin-geolocation 2.1.0), the location
> capability is missing from the appxmanifest file.
> In the platforms/windows folder, the file "package.windows.appxmanifest"
> contains the following region:
> <Capabilities>
> <Capability Name="internetClient" />
> <DeviceCapability Name="location" />
> </Capabilities>
> The file "package.phone.appxmanifest", which seems to be relevant when
> building for the ARM platform, is missing the location entry:
> <Capabilities>
> <Capability Name="internetClientServer" />
> </Capabilities>
> I don't know whether this is a bug in the geolocation plugin (which should
> add the permission) or in the windows platform. I was able to fix the problem
> for me by extending the plugin.xml of the geolocation plugin and adding:
> <config-file target="package.phone.appxmanifest"
> parent="/Package/Capabilities">
> <DeviceCapability Name="location" />
> </config-file>
> This seems to be a bug because the existing extra with
> target="package.appxmanifest" works for the file package.windows.appxmanifest
> but not for package.phone.appxmanifest.
> Edit: The build target was "Windows Phone (Universal)" from Visual Studio
> 2015, which results in creating an app package with the following name:
> "CordovaApp.Phone_<version>_arm.appxupload
